Meghan Markle and Prince Harry reportedly keen to take baby Archie to America
Meghan Markle and Prince Harry are reportedly keen to take baby Archie to America.
Meghan Markle and Prince Harry welcomed their first child together only a few weeks ago, but it seems as if they’re already keen to take their new little one on his first trip to America.
The Duke and Duchess of Sussex have kept relatively low-key since little Archie arrived earlier this month.
Of course they treated royal fans to a glimpse of the newborn when they stepped out at Windsor and presented him to the world.
But apart from that appearance the public haven’t seen anything of the Duchess of Sussex and the newest royal family member.
Though little Archie has been busy meeting other members of his family.

In his first week he was introduced to his great-grandparents The Queen and Prince Philip, and of course his maternal grandmother Doria Ragland.
Prince William and Kate Middleton also had the chance to meet little Archie, although there’s still no word on whether he’s been introduced to older cousins Prince George, Princess Charlotte and Prince Louis, who are apparently desperate to meet him.
But it looks like the little royal will soon be making his way stateside to be introduced to a whole different world.
A royal source has come out and confirmed that California-born Meghan is desperate to take her new son over to the US to familiarise him with the other side of his roots and heritage.
‘For Meghan, it’s just as important for Archie to learn about her family history as it is for him to learn about his royal ancestors,’ a source told US Weekly, ‘so she plans to go on a trip to L.A. with him once she’s comfortable taking him on a plane.’
However, it’s likely that the new parents will want to get little Archie’s christening out of the way before planning their first big family trip.
